 Earlier this week I received the pleasure of being invited to view indie horror outfit CatchMeKillMe Production's promo for their upcoming vlog. After being "shock teased" by tantalizing pictures on their Facebook of a bloody vixen in a tub, I jumped at the opportunity.
The clip, shown above, is pretty self explanatory, so I need not go into all of the gory details, however I will spout my opinion on the production crew itself.
In the clip, CMKM proclaims that they are "here for fear," and honestly, judging by some of their most recent video posts, Director Ian Messenger and the crew aren't messing around.
Scared of clowns? CMKM has that covered. Scared of being kidnapped by a psychopath? CMKM has that too. Did I mention that they also explore serial killer and zombie territory? Whatever your twisted pleasure, CMKM either has it on film already, or its in the works.
Yes, some may say there are some indie "mistakes" made in some of the films, but that isn't CMKM's fault, it's truly in the eye of the beholder! Plus, we all make mistakes in indie film, trust me, I know I have. We just learn from them and move on.
Judging by the progression CMKM has made from their first, awesome, film "The Day The World Went Away," Messenger and the family are on the path to success.
Although their videos currently reign on their YouTube channel, they are definitely a name to look out for in the near future on the big screen.
